Q: Is 6,741,065 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 6,741,065 is not a prime number.

Why is 6,741,065 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 6741065 can be evenly divided by 1 5 1,097 1,229 5,485 6,145 1,348,213 and 6,741,065, with no remainder.

Since 6,741,065 cannot be divided by just 1 and 6,741,065, it is not a prime number.
